  • Profile picture of the author Bill Hugall
    I didn't see a single "call to action" on your site. You opt-in box contains the following statement. "Imagine 5lbs gone" They already do that everyday Also my guess is that the people at your site are concerned with more then 5lbs. They are at your site so you can tell them what to do. Really sounds simple but people get stuck in follow mode. The equation should look like this.

    Their problem. State it loud so they see it. "Keep buying products that promise you will lose 50lbs and you never seem lose 10?

    Solution My free ebook will cover everything from diet and sleep to exercise and the pitfalls you may encounter along you journey.Your success is my only goal.

    CALL TO ACTION Sign-up for my free ebook today!!!! Follow everything it says and I guarantee you will lose 10lbs in the next 2 weeks. Limited copies so sign-up today and get your life moving back in the right direction.

    Obviously a little crude but I wanted the process to be clear. Play with it, but have those 3 steps covered.

    Also way too many fields on your opt-in box. I might keep your ads specific to you niche.

    If you are looking for sales from your home page I would have some kind of sales copy.

    Also I would suggest that most of your visitors will become loyal to you as you are starting your challenge. Good for you by the way!!!!! I would guess that they will also be waiting for the results of a leader. So I see far more sales rolling in as you progress.

    I hope that helps

    • Profile picture of the author Troy Boyd
      Hey there Shay,

      Okay first of all here's the good news. Getting 71K unique visitors isn't chump change. You've got one of the hardest parts out of the way already...providing that these are truly unique visitors.

      I'd take a very hard look at where these visitors are coming from. But again, if these are targeted or even semi-targeted visitors, then as you make changes you should get very fast feedback of whether or not it works.

      Okay... THINGS TO THINK ABOUT CHANGING...

      First off, the blog looks very scattered to me. It's lacking focus.

      Your subject line says "71k visitors and no sales" but the question is...

      What are you trying to sell?

      I think that you need to work that out first, and then turn this page into a hyper focused machine to sell just that.

      Of course you want the subscribers right? So focus on ways of getting those subscribers. I'd get rid of all of the banners below your optin box, and start tweaking the headline above the subscriber box first. Much like "Bilkat19" suggested.

      Focus on their main problem which is likely "losing weight" and give them something worth leaving their info. I might suggest doing away with the name field altogether and just asking for email address. Once they're on your list, and you gain their trust, then you can even lead them to another optin page of some sort where you'll more easily get their name, and even more perhaps (phone, address)...and they'll be a much stronger lead at that point.

      For a headline I'd go with something more like: "Get My Free Guide to Jump Start Your Weight Loss" and then start making changes from there. Perhaps even offer a free 15 minute coaching strategy as a free gift or something since that's where you said you'd like to start focusing to set yourself apart.

      So "Enter Your Email Address and Get My Free Guide to Jump Start Your Weight Loss... Plus a Free 15 Minute Coaching Session...Limited Spots Available"

      That's just something on the fly -- might be a little long -- but you see how it shows them what they'll get right off the bat, plus it adds a bonus element.

      Second... Like ICoachU said, make your first post a full one, and then excerpt the rest, or hide them altogether. Your time on page will increase, and it will help people notice the optin box more clearly as well...especially once you get rid of the banners below it.

      Third... Under your picture, I would change that to a quick little bit of info about YOU. Very quick blurb about who you are, where you're from, and why you want to help.

      I'd wait and mention the challenge in an email series once they've joined your list.

      Personally I'd ditch most of the links at the top of the page, except for Shay's Story, Product info, Samples, and Contact Us!

      But that's up to you. It just looks very busy.

      And one more thing that I think would help is in your posts, definitely add more real pictures of you, or other people. Those other pictures scream loudly that you're just trying to sell things, but personal pics pique curiosity and add the human element. People respond much more kindly to that.

      Plus if this is MLM, you're selling you so you want to start making that connection right away.

      Alright hope some of this helps. Good luck and if you have any questions shoot me a PM.

  • Profile picture of the author Jacob Lot
    I think your first bet is to capitalize on your current visitors.

    Here is EXACTLY what to do:

    Find something that will benefit your prospect from their problem IMMEDIATELY (this is very important)

    Example: My prospect wants to lose weight. Okay, so I have this 5 page eBook that says that they should drink 2 glasses of water before each meal. I explain the benefits of that and why it works to help lose weight. Now I offer this ebook in exchange for name + email and I say: "Hey, want a quick method that requires NO EXERCISE will help you start losing weight TODAY... Enter your name and email address below"

    You see? With something like that, at least 30% of everyone that comes to your website will give you their name and email.

    Now if you want to bump that 30% to 40+% then I suggest you get the Popup Domination plugin and have that pop so visitors will be more likely to enter in the name and email.

    Once you are generating a consistent amount of leads. Learn how to build a relationship, follow up then sell.

  • Profile picture of the author KirkMcD
    It seems that most of your Stumbleupon traffic is coming to this page:
    ViSalus By Shay » Blog ArchiveLose 10lbs in 7 Days Cleanse

    There is nothing there encourage the visitor to do anything to your benefit.

    For breakfast and lunch I will have one of my delicious shakes mixed with either orange juice (no pulp and no sugar added) or water. I won’t add fruits to the shakes though.
    You have Shakes as a link to your sales site, but nothing in that paragraph is encouraging me to check it out.

    But I think the biggest problem is that link on Stumbleupon takes them to your mobile site. The mobile site doesn't have your sidebar with the signup form and the advertising.
    They just see the article. You might want to fix that.
